All-Purpose Oatmeal Bread Dough
Ingredients:
wheat flours, bread, unenriched
oats
sugars, granulated
salt, table
butter, without salt
milk, fluid, 1% fat, without added vitamin a and vitamin d
leavening agents, yeast, baker's, active dry
Directions:
Place all of the ingredients into the bread maker case and put the yeast into the yeast container.
Leave the bread maker to do everything as far as the first rising.
After the first rising, divide into as many pieces as you like, cover with plastic wrap and a damp cloth, and let sit for 20 minutes.
Next, transfer into whatever baking pan you are using The main photo that I uploaded shows iced apple custard rolls.
This time I made walnut and red bean paste rolls.
Leave rise for a second time by using your oven's bread proofing function at 40C for 20~25 minutes.
This is where you should coat with the glaze.
Bake for 13-15 minutes in an oven that has been preheated to 180C, and then they are complete.
